Gilberto wants Juve, as expected…

November 23rd, 2007

All Arsenal fans already know the story, Flamini takes Gilberto place, Gilberto looks for an out, Gilberto finds destination. The guy wants to go to Juventus, so if he said it so clearly like that, then it is already done. Juventus were expected also to sign a top class midfielder. I like Gilberto’s style but Wenger has my full trust as usual, in addition the player is 31 years of age. So I guess this move will give Diarra the chance he always wanted.

Here what Gilberto had to say today to “La Gazzetta dello Sport” about a move to Turin:

“I would willingly go to Turin, Juve are a prestigious club and they have already overcome their problems following their demotion to Serie B.

I would adapt myself well to the Italian league, however Juve should know that I have no intention of starting a war with Arsenal.”

Gilberto added: “Buffon is the best goalkeeper in the world and it is true that he is a symbol of Juve. Del Piero is a player with large prestige on the international stage. As for me, well I do not have the feet of a Ronaldinho, but I do know how to organise a team”.
